<p><strong>SAN RAMON</strong> &#8212; Complete Solaria, a solar technology, services, and installation company, has received a $10 million strategic investment from Foris Ventures, LLC, an entity affiliated with John Doerr, Chairman of venture capital firm Kleiner Perkins.</p>
<p>The commitment is part of a previously announced $30 million bridge round, in support of Complete Solaria’s previously announced business combination with Freedom Acquisition I Corp.(NYSE: FACT), and is being made in the form of a firm commitment to purchase $10 million of convertible notes.</p>
<p>“We are thrilled to gain the support of such a well-respected business leader and investor,” said Will Anderson, CEO of Complete Solaria.</p>
<p>Doerr currently serves on the board of directors of Alphabet, Coursera, and DoorDash.</p>
<p>The $10 million strategic investment from Foris Ventures is in addition to previously announced progress on the bridge funding, which included a $14.2 million from T.J. Rodgers, $3.5 million from Freedom’s sponsors and $2 million from other investors.</p>
